My X Mag goes full auto when i pull the trigger! Its well lubricated and the main spring is longer than the bolt. As it is set up it was previously working ok. Though the trigger did have a tendency to bounce lots and would go full auto occasionally. Sounds like a problem that has been getting progressively worse over time. Can anyone advise on how to get it back to normal please?!?!

shaunyoung000
09-23-2006, 12:16 PM
sear is probably wore, check it out and replace.
however if it's in electro mode and still doing that, well I don't know what to tell you, never had that problem before.

you have an X valve not an X mag, big difference. since you changed sears check your trigger rod length, aired up safety on trigger held back you want a credit card thickness gap between the end of the rod and back of the trigger. as for the other problem what spring are you using on the bolt? what hopper and which power feed plug do you have.
